Let me start by saying I love new trends. Sometimes I get on the bandwagon a bit later than other fashionistas, but don’t you agree trends make dressing so much more exciting?

I do realize that the 70s trend is either love or hate, though! I’m 100% sold, but I’m not gonna go crazy shopping for all the new 70s inspired garments. I have a better idea – why not make it work with what we already have? I have to admit that it would be harder to recreate a similar look without flares, but that is one of the 70s inspired pieces that I really recommend investing in, because they are here to stay. In this look I incorporated four things I love about about the 70s:

1. Flares, obviously :)
2. Wearing turtlenecks under light jackets or shirts
3. Safari-inspired outerwear (in my case this is a utility jacket I bought a while ago)
4. Cinched waist (preferably wider belts)
